The Fluke MODULIFT2M is a professional-grade ladder pulley system designed specifically for solar panel installation. It belongs to the niche category of material handling tools that prioritize safety and efficiency. The primary purpose is to allow a single installer to lift solar panels weighing up to 60 pounds from the ground to the roof without straining their back or risking a fall. The standout innovation is its ultra-fast setup time of under five minutes by one person. This is a game changer for crews that move between multiple job sites daily. The system includes a 60-foot rope, a metal pulley mechanism, and all necessary attachment hardware. First, safely extend your ladder and ensure it is on stable ground. Attach the mounting bracket to the top rung of your extension ladder. The straps are self-tightening. Then, hook the pulley unit onto the bracket. Thread the 60-foot rope through the pulley. That is it. The entire process took us under four minutes on our first try. No tools are required, which makes site transitions fast.
Before lifting a panel, test the system with a light load (like a tool bag) to ensure the rope glides smoothly. The pulley has a locking mechanism that prevents accidental free-fall. Familiarize yourself with the rope tension. There is no battery or interface to learn. You simply pull the rope to lift and let the rope gently lower the panel. The simplicity is a major advantage when you are training new crew members.
Place a solar panel on the ground directly under the pulley. Attach the rope hook securely to the panel’s frame. From the roof, pull the rope to lift the panel. Use steady, even pulls to avoid swinging. The pulley design ensures smooth movement. Always keep one hand on the rope. For best results, have a spotter on the ground until you are comfortable. We found that lifting a 50-pound panel took about 40 seconds.
Experienced users can attach a second rope for lateral guidance, which prevents the panel from twisting in windy conditions. You can also use the system on a steeper pitch by adjusting the bracket angle. Another pro tip: tie a small bag of tools to the rope’s lower end to act as a counterweight for easier lowering. After each use, inspect the rope for fraying or damage. Rinse the metal pulley with fresh water if exposed to dirt or salt air. Lubricate the pulley bearings with a silicone-based spray every 20 uses. Store the rope loosely coiled in a dry container to prevent kinks. Proper maintenance will keep this system working like new for years. Check out our solar tool maintenance guide for more tips.
If the rope sticks, check for dirt in the pulley groove and clean it. If the bracket slips, tighten the straps further. If lifting feels harder than expected, ensure the rope is not twisted around itself. For these and other fixes, the user manual provides clear diagrams. Attach a second short rope to the panel’s lower edge to let a ground person steer it away from obstacles during windy conditions. This prevents damage and increases control.
Apply a dry lubricant to the pulley bearings every 30 days of active use. This keeps the rope running smoothly and extends the life of the mechanism.
Use a solar panel dolly to move modules from the truck to the ladder base. This reduces ground-level strain and speeds up the overall workflow.
Coil the rope loosely in a dedicated bag or bucket. Avoid tight knots that cause kinks. A kinked rope reduces lifespan and creates uneven pull.
Before each work week, inspect the entire system for wear. Checking the hook, straps, and rope can prevent on-site failures.
Consider purchasing a spare 60-foot rope from an aftermarket supplier. Having a backup on the truck avoids downtime if the original gets damaged.
Spend 15 minutes at the start of a project to train every installer on using the system. Quick cross-training ensures everyone can operate it safely and efficiently.
